What is UPVC?

UPVC is a type of plastic that is extensively used in the building and construction industry, especially for doors and window frames. Unlike routine PVC, UPVC does not contain plasticizers, which makes it stiff and ideal for structural applications. The material is resistant to moisture and environmental destruction, giving it a longer life-span compared to conventional products like wood and metal.

Advantages of UPVC Windows and Doors

  1. Durability: UPVC is highly resistant to rot, corrosion, and fading, making it an exceptional option for environments with extreme weather.

  2. Energy Efficiency: UPVC frames can help improve the energy performance of homes. They are excellent insulators, which means they can assist minimize heating & cooling costs.

  3. Low Maintenance: Unlike wood frames that might require routine painting and sealing, UPVC can simply be cleaned up with soap and water, preserving its look with very little effort.

  4. Affordable: Although the initial financial investment might be greater than aluminum or wood alternatives, the long lifespan and low upkeep requirements of UPVC make it a more economical choice with time.

  5. Aesthetically Pleasing: UPVC windows and doors come in numerous designs and colors, guaranteeing homeowners can find an option that complements their property.

Kinds Of UPVC Windows and Doors

UPVC products come in different styles to fit different architectural styles and personal choices. Some common types consist of:

Windows:

  1. Casement Windows: Hinged at the side, these windows open outward, supplying excellent ventilation.
  2. Sliding Windows: These windows operate on a track, enabling simple opening and closing.
  3. Sash Windows: Featuring sliding panes, sash windows offer a standard appearance and functionality.
  4. Tilt and Turn Windows: Versatile in style, these windows can tilt for ventilation or turn fully for simple cleansing.

Doors:

  1. UPVC Front Doors: Designed to offer security and insulation, these doors are readily available in different designs.
  2. French Doors: These double doors open outward and create a seamless link to outside spaces.
  3. Sliding Patio Doors: Ideal for making the most of views and natural light, these doors operate smoothly along a track.
  4. Bi-fold Doors: These doors can fold back to produce an open space, perfect for amusing or linking indoor and outdoor areas.

Installation Process

The installation of UPVC doors and windows is essential for guaranteeing their functionality and durability. Here are the key actions involved in the installation procedure:

  1. Measurement: Accurate measurements of the existing openings are taken.

  2. Preparation: The old frames are gotten rid of, and the location is cleaned and prepped for the new installation.

  3. Positioning: The new UPVC frames are positioned, ensuring they fit comfortably within the openings.

  4. Sealing: The frames are sealed using suitable sealing materials to avoid drafts and water ingress.

  5. Finishing: Final adjustments are made to ensure the windows & doors company and doors run smoothly, and any finishing touches are included.

Maintenance Tips for UPVC Windows and Doors

To keep UPVC doors and windows in good condition, the following upkeep suggestions are suggested:

  1. Regular Cleaning: Use a moist fabric or sponge with mild soap to wipe down the frames and glass surface areas. Avoid extreme chemicals that can damage the product.

  2. Examine Seals and Locks: Regularly inspect the sealing and locking mechanisms to guarantee they are working correctly.

  3. Oil Moving Parts: Use a silicone-based lube on hinges and locks to keep them operating efficiently.

  4. Examine for Damage: Periodically examine for any noticeable damage or wear to attend to issues before they escalate.

Frequently Asked Questions About UPVC Windows and Doors

  1. How long do UPVC windows and doors last?

    • UPVC windows and doors can last upwards of 20 years with proper maintenance.
  2. Are UPVC products energy effective?

    • Yes, UPVC offers excellent insulation residential or commercial properties, which can substantially enhance energy efficiency in homes.
  3. Can UPVC windows be painted?

    • While UPVC can be painted, it's typically not suggested, as this may void service warranties and affect the product's stability.
  4. Are UPVC products recyclable?

    • Yes, UPVC is recyclable, making it an eco-friendly option.
  5. Can I install UPVC windows and doors myself?

    • While DIY setup is possible, it is advised to work with professionals for correct and secure setup.
